16
schema.xml中片段:Solr的 - 查詢在各個領域的最佳實踐
<field name="id" type="string" indexed="true" stored="true" required="true" />
<field name="notes" type="text_general" indexed="true" stored="true"/>
<field name="missionFocus" type="text_general" indexed="true" stored="true"/>
<field name="name" type="text_general" indexed="true" stored="true"/>
<field name="first_name" type="text_general" indexed="true" stored="true"/>
<field name="last_name" type="text_general" indexed="true" stored="true"/>
<field name="about_me" type="text_general" indexed="true" stored="true"/>
<field name="message" type="text_general" indexed="true" stored="true"/>
<field name="title" type="text_general" indexed="true" stored="true"/>
<field name="table_type" type="string" indexed="true" stored="true"/>
<field name="text" type="text_general" indexed="true" stored="false"
multiValued="true"/>
現在我想在各個領域進行搜索(除了「id」和「TABLE_TYPE」)爲例如「你好」。我如何做到這一點?我真的必須寫下面的內容嗎?
/solr/select/?q=notes:hello missionFocus:hello name:hello first_name:hello ..
我聽說過關於DisMaxRequestHandler的一些信息,但是我怎麼用這個處理程序來查詢呢?我需要改變solrconfig.xml中的內容嗎?
我想我已經定義了一個名爲「text」的「收藏家」字段? :)好吧,我只是從示例schema.xml中複製它。 – user1731299
這是正確的:「文本」是solr示例項目中的等效字段;-) – heinob
如果我想根據哪個字段匹配來調整評分,該怎麼辦? – faridasabry